Can I wirelessly transfer 5.1 channel sound over bluetooth to my soundbar?

Bluetooth is very old technology and it was developed when stereo was the cutting edge sound so dont expect any miracles. As stated by others bluetooth will give you 2 channel sound with a very ordinary bitrate. You can forget FLAC and all the other lossless formats, once they pass through the Bluetooth system they will end up about the same as an MP3.I have a pair of fairly good dual circuit head phones (Bluetooth and Cable) these have obviously had a fair bit of tweaking at the factory because the Bluetooth doesn't sound too bad but when they are connected by cable the difference is amazing.Don't get me wrong, Bluetooth has its place, I use Bluetooth phones while working, exercising, even while mowing the grass, in situations where orchestral quality isn't required the portability is a winner.The $64,000 question is, how long will Bluetooth last. Probably a long time especially where a lower quality sound is acceptable. But for HIFI audio situations I suspect the writing is on the wall. WIFI may well replace Bluetooth, better bandwidth, much greater range and most of us already have WIFI in our homes and businesses. Does Bluetooth have enough bandwidth to support 5.1 audio?

The tougher issue with 5.1 sound over Bluetooth is synchronization for the sounds from each speaker as well as with the image on the screen. (Lip sync.) The sound source would send sound information to each speaker in turn, one after the other, like dealing cards. If the speaker immediately plays sounds received, there will be slight differences between each speaker. If each speaker buffers the sound until all the sound has been delivered such that they all play the sound for a given time, additional latency is introduced. (Buffering and timing requirements are also introduced with this solution.) This latency can grow such that a voice is heard well after you see their lips move on the display which is very awkward to watch. The video can be delayed to allow for the latency, but the timing issue continues to grow as more things are delayed and timed to occur together. There are issues to create such a solution, but companies have spent the effort to do so. I don’t know the quality of these solutions as I haven’t personally tried them.
